In 2019-2020, 9,599 people earned their degree in statistics, making the major the 88th most popular in the United States. In 2017-2018, statistics gra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$61,950 and had an average of $22,199 in loans still to pay off.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Portland State University. The school came in at #1 for the Best Vallue Stats Schools in Oregon For Those Making Over $110k. Portland State University is a large school located in Portland, Oregon that handed out 14 ’s stats degrees in 2019-2020.
Portland State University also made our “Best Statistics Schools in Oregon” list, coming in at #2. The yearly cost to attend Portland State University is $13,040 for Oregon Stats students whose families make more than $110k.
You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Oregon State University. It ranked #2 on our 2022 Best Vallue Stats Schools in Oregon For Those Making Over $110k list. This large school is located in Corvallis, Oregon, and it awarded 41 ’s stats degrees in 2019-2020.
As a testament to the quality of education offered at Oregon State, the school also landed the #1 spot in our “Best Statistics Schools in Oregon” ranking. The estimated yearly cost for Oregon State University is $20,016 for Oregon Stats students whose families make more than $110k.
The student loan default rate at the school is 3.4%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%. The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 85%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year.
